Russia is redeploying air defenses to shield a key bridge used by Russia to connect with the annexed Crimean Peninsula that Ukraine has long targeted, according to a Crimean-based pro-Ukrainian group. "The Armed Forces of the Russian Federation began to massively transfer equipment closer to the Kerch Bridge," Atesh, a pro-Kyiv military partisan group of Ukrainians and Crimean Tatars, said in a post to messaging app Telegram on Thursday. The California Supreme Court on Thursday upheld Proposition 22, the voter initiative that allows Uber, Lyft and other gig economy companies to classify drivers for their ride-hailing and delivery services as independent contractors rather than as employees. In a unanimous decision released Thursday morning, the state’s top court rejected claims brought by a group of drivers and unions that the law is unconstitutional because it interferes with lawmakers’ authority over matters dealing with worker compensation.
